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Damage Restoration
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don't ignore the warning signs, act quickly to prevent further damage.
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
Shows water damage or mold growth. If you notice a musty smell that persists, it's time to call our team.
Warping Wood or Water Stains
Signals water damage or excessive moisture. Don't wait, address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.
Discoloration or Warping of Flooring
Shows water damage or uneven drying. Our team can help you identify the cause and provide a solution.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Suggests water damage or excessive moisture. Don't ignore these signs, address them qu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Damage on Walls or Ceilings
Shows a leak or water seepage.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Signals a moisture issue. Don't wait, address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.

Condo Water Damage Restoration Cost in City View, SC
The cost of condo water damage restoration in City View, SC, varies based on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on typical scenarios and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500 - $2,500 | Size of the affected area and equipment needed |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of the affected area and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$500 - $2,000 | Size of the affected area and materials needed |
| Repair and reconstruction | $2,000 - $10,000 | Size of the affected area and materials needed |
| Final inspection and certification | $200 - $1,000 | Size of the affected area and complexity of the job |

Common Questions About Condo Water Damage Restoration
Q: What causes water damage in condos?
Leaks, burst pipes, and heavy rainfall are common causes of water damage in condos.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ent these issues.
Q: How long does water damage restoration take?
Typically 3-5 days depending on the severity of the damage and the complexity of the job. Our team will work with you to ensure a timely and successful restoration.
